Dr. Samir Saba, MD is a cardiologist in Pittsburgh, PA. Dr. Saba has extensive experience in Cardiac Electrical System Procedures and Cardiac Implantable Device Procedures. He is affiliated with medical facilities such as UPMC Presbyterian and UPMC Altoona. He is accepting new patients.
